Dimensional reduction and fermion families
Abstract
We present here several examples of gauge theories in 6 dimensions for which families of Fermions are obtained in the process of dimensional reduction. It is not necessary to have an explicit horizontal group to relate families. In fact, theories with horizontal groups do not exhibit spontaneous breaking of the horizontal symmetry due to the dimensional Higgs fields.
